A Korean man who was kidnapped by militants in the Philippines two weeks ago has been released and reunited with his family Seoul′s foreign ministry says the 55-year-old, with the family name Yoon, is back at his home in the Philippines after his wife handed over an undisclosed amount of money to his abductors While driving in Mindanao, the Philippines′ easternmost island, Yoon was abducted by armed militants who threatened to kill him if they were not paid a ransom This is the latest kidnapping in the Philippines targeting Koreans Last year 10 Koreans were killed in the country
